This 1-day symposium will highlight research projects that reflect the Emancipatory Research framework. The event is being hosted by

Dr. Cirecie West-Olatunji will feature Dr. Joyce E. King, Benjamin E. Mays endowed chair at Georgia State University, as the keynote speaker.

Concurrent seminars will follow the keynote session, during which presenters will share their recent Emancipatory Research projects.
